Event Description

Appreciate the beauty of wild flora through this fun and engaging art activity.

Children and accompanying adults will be led on a small walk around the park by artist Jo Sharpe, gathering weeds and leaves, before returning to Oaks Park Café via Jo's professional art studio, located in Oaks Park. There, children will be given an inspiring lesson on observing and appreciating nature, learning to represent it through multiple mediums.
